投稿者: mika

  • フレームワーク学習に役立つアプリ開発のポイントは?

    フレームワーク学習に役立つアプリ開発のポイントは?

    フレームワークを使った学習の重要性

    フレームワークを使った学習は、アプリ開発の効率を大幅に向上させます。あなたも、アプリ開発におけるフレームワークの重要性を感じているのではないでしょうか。フレームワークは、開発者が直面するさまざまな課題を解決するための便利なツールです。特に、学習段階にあるあなたには、フレームワークを理解し活用することが必要不可欠です。

    フレームワークを学ぶことで、あなたの開発スキルは確実に向上します。特に、アプリ開発の現場では、迅速なプロトタイピングや効率的なコード管理が求められます。フレームワークを使うことで、これらの要件に応えることができるのです。

    フレームワークの選び方

    フレームワークを学ぶ際には、どのフレームワークを選ぶかが重要です。あなたに合ったフレームワークを選ぶためのポイントを以下に示します。

    1. プロジェクトの目的を明確にする

    まず、あなたが開発するアプリの目的を明確にしましょう。目的によって、適切なフレームワークが変わります。例えば、ウェブアプリを作成する場合、ReactやVue.jsなどが適しています。

    2. 学習コストを考慮する

    フレームワークには学習コストが存在します。あなたの現在のスキルレベルに応じて、学習が容易なフレームワークを選ぶことが重要です。初心者には、ドキュメントが充実しているものをおすすめします。

    3. コミュニティの活発さを確認する

    フレームワークの選定において、コミュニティの活発さも重要な要素です。大規模なコミュニティを持つフレームワークは、情報が豊富でサポートも受けやすいです。あなたが問題に直面した際に、解決策を見つけやすくなります。

    フレームワーク学習アプリの活用

    フレームワークを学ぶためのアプリも数多く存在します。これらのアプリを活用することで、効率的に学習を進めることができます。以下におすすめのアプリを紹介します。

    1. Udemy

    Udemyは、さまざまなフレームワークに関するコースが豊富に揃っています。あなたが興味のあるフレームワークについて、専門家から直接学べるので、非常に有益です。

    2. Codecademy

    Codecademyは、インタラクティブな学習が特徴のプラットフォームです。あなたが実際に手を動かしながら学べるため、理解が深まります。

    3. Coursera

    Courseraは、大学や専門機関と提携したコースを提供しています。あなたが学びたいフレームワークに関連する大学の講義を受けることができ、より深い知識を得ることができます。

    フレームワーク学習の具体的なステップ

    あなたがフレームワークを学ぶ際の具体的なステップを示します。これらを参考にして、効率的な学習を進めましょう。

    1. 基本的な概念を理解する

    まずは、フレームワークの基本的な概念を理解しましょう。ドキュメントやオンラインコースを利用して、基礎を固めることが重要です。

    2. 実際に手を動かす

    基本を理解したら、実際に手を動かしてみましょう。小さなプロジェクトを立ち上げて、フレームワークを使ってみることで、実践的なスキルが身につきます。

    3. コードを共有しフィードバックを得る

    あなたが書いたコードをGitHubなどのプラットフォームで共有し、他の開発者からフィードバックを受けることも大切です。これにより、自分では気づかなかった改善点に気づくことができます。

    フレームワークを学ぶメリット

    フレームワークを学ぶことで得られるメリットは数多くあります。あなたがフレームワークを学ぶべき理由を以下にまとめました。

    • 効率的な開発が可能になる
    • コードの再利用性が向上する
    • チーム開発が円滑になる
    • 最新の技術トレンドに対応できるようになる
    • コミュニティからのサポートが受けられる

    フレームワークを学ぶことで、これらのメリットを享受できます。特に、アプリ開発を進める上で、フレームワークの知識は不可欠です。

    まとめ

    フレームワークはアプリ開発において非常に重要な役割を果たします。あなたがフレームワークを学ぶことで、開発スキルが向上し、効率的な開発が可能になります。適切なフレームワークの選定や学習アプリの活用、具体的な学習ステップを踏むことで、あなたのスキルは確実に向上します。フレームワークを学び、アプリ開発の世界を楽しんでください。

  • フレームワークを使った学習アプリの開発に必要な知識は?

    フレームワークを使った学習アプリの開発に必要な知識は?

    フレームワーク学習の必要性

    最近、アプリ開発の現場ではフレームワークの重要性が増しています。あなたは、アプリ開発におけるフレームワークの学習がどれほど必要か疑問に思っているかもしれません。

    フレームワークを学ぶことによって、開発効率が大幅に向上することが期待できます。特に、時間が限られている中で質の高いアプリを開発するには、フレームワークの利用が欠かせません。あなたがもし、アプリ開発において効率的な方法を探しているのなら、フレームワークの学習は避けて通れない道と言えるでしょう。

    フレームワークの選び方

    あなたがアプリ開発に必要なフレームワークを選ぶ際、考慮すべきポイントがあります。

    1. プロジェクトの目的

    まず、プロジェクトの目的を明確にすることが重要です。あなたが開発するアプリが何を実現したいのかを考えることで、適切なフレームワークを見つける手助けになります。

    2. 開発言語

    次に、使用するプログラミング言語に応じてフレームワークを選ぶ必要があります。例えば、JavaScriptであればReactやVue.js、PythonであればDjangoやFlaskなどがあります。あなたのスキルセットに合ったフレームワークを選ぶことで、学習がスムーズに進むでしょう。

    3. コミュニティの活発さ

    フレームワークの選定において、コミュニティの活発さも重要な要素です。活発なコミュニティがあると、問題解決のための情報を得やすくなります。あなたが困ったときに助けを得られる環境は、学習を続ける上で大きな助けになるでしょう。

    おすすめのフレームワーク

    ここでは、特に人気のあるフレームワークをいくつか紹介します。あなたの学習の参考にしてみてください。

    • React.js: ユーザーインターフェースを構築するためのライブラリで、コンポーネントベースの開発が可能です。
    • Vue.js: 軽量で扱いやすく、学習コストが低いフレームワークです。初心者にもおすすめです。
    • Angular: 大規模アプリケーションの開発に適したフレームワークで、強力なツールが揃っています。
    • Django: Pythonのフレームワークで、迅速な開発が可能です。セキュリティも重視されています。
    • Flutter: クロスプラットフォームのアプリ開発が可能で、モバイルアプリの開発に最適です。

    フレームワーク学習の方法

    フレームワークを学ぶための具体的な方法をいくつか紹介します。あなたの学習スタイルに合った方法を選んでみてください。

    1. オンラインコース

    多くのプラットフォームで、フレームワークのオンラインコースが提供されています。UdemyやCourseraなどで、実際のプロジェクトを通じて学ぶことができます。

    2. 書籍

    フレームワークに特化した書籍も多数出版されています。あなたの興味のあるフレームワークについての書籍を手に取って、じっくりと学ぶのも良いでしょう。

    3. プロジェクトを作成する

    実際にプロジェクトを作成することが、最も効果的な学習方法です。あなたのアイデアを形にすることで、フレームワークの使い方を体感することができます。

    フレームワーク学習の落とし穴

    フレームワークを学ぶ際には、いくつかの落とし穴があります。あなたも注意が必要です。

    1. 基礎をおろそかにする

    フレームワークを学ぶあまり、プログラミングの基礎をおろそかにすることがあります。基礎がないと、フレームワークを使いこなすことは難しいでしょう。

    2. フレームワーク依存症

    フレームワークに依存しすぎると、他の選択肢を見逃すことがあります。あなたがフレームワークを学ぶ際には、柔軟な思考を持つことが大切です。

    3. 最新技術への追随

    技術の進化は早く、新しいフレームワークが次々に登場します。あなたは一つのフレームワークに固執せず、常に最新情報をキャッチアップする姿勢が求められます。

    まとめ

    フレームワークの学習は、アプリ開発において欠かせない要素です。あなたが適切なフレームワークを選び、効果的な学習方法を実践することで、開発効率が向上し、質の高いアプリを作成できるでしょう。フレームワークに対する理解を深めることで、あなたのアプリ開発スキルは飛躍的に向上するはずです。

  • Java Androidプログラミングを学べるおすすめのスクールは?

    Java Androidプログラミングを学べるおすすめのスクールは?

    Java Android プログラミング スクールに関する疑問

    1. Java Android プログラミングを学ぶ必要性は?

    あなたがJava Android プログラミングを学ぶ必要性を感じている理由は、多くの人がスマートフォンやタブレットを使用する現代において、アプリ開発の需要が高まっているからです。特にAndroidアプリは世界中で広く使われており、開発者としてのスキルを身につけることで、キャリアの選択肢が広がります。

    また、JavaはAndroid開発の主要な言語であり、学ぶことで多くのフレームワークやライブラリにアクセスできるようになります。これにより、効率的な開発が可能となり、自分のアイデアを形にする力が身につくでしょう。

    2. Java Android プログラミングスクールはどのように選ぶべき?

    あなたがJava Android プログラミングスクールを選ぶ際には、いくつかのポイントを考慮する必要があります。まず、カリキュラムの内容です。実際のプロジェクトに基づいた実践的な内容が含まれているか確認しましょう。

    次に、講師の質です。経験豊富な講師がいるか、過去の受講生の評価を参考にすることも大切です。さらに、スクールのサポート体制や卒業後の就職支援も重要な要素です。

    • カリキュラムの内容
    • 講師の質
    • サポート体制
    • 卒業後の就職支援

    3. オンラインと対面、どちらのスクールが良いのか?

    あなたがオンラインと対面のどちらのスクールを選ぶかは、ライフスタイルや学習スタイルによります。オンラインスクールは、自宅で好きな時間に学習できるため、時間の自由度が高いです。

    一方、対面スクールは、直接講師から学べるため、質問がしやすく、仲間との交流が生まれることも魅力です。どちらにもメリットがありますので、自分に合ったスタイルを選ぶことが大切です。

    4. Java Android プログラミングを学ぶメリットは?

    あなたがJava Android プログラミングを学ぶことで得られるメリットは多岐にわたります。まず、アプリ開発のスキルを身につけることで、フリーランスや企業での仕事のチャンスが増えます。

    さらに、自分のアイデアを形にする楽しさや、ユーザーからのフィードバックを受け取ることで成長できることも大きな魅力です。実際にアプリをリリースした際の達成感は、他の分野では得難いものがあります。

    5. どのくらいの期間で習得できるのか?

    あなたがJava Android プログラミングを習得するための期間は、個々の学習ペースやスクールのカリキュラムによって異なりますが、一般的には数ヶ月から1年程度と考えられます。

    多くのスクールでは、週に数回の授業と自主学習を組み合わせており、実践的なプロジェクトを通じて学ぶことができます。これにより、短期間で効率的にスキルを習得できるでしょう。

    まとめ

    Java Android プログラミングを学ぶことは、キャリアの選択肢を広げ、自己実現の手段として非常に価値があります。スクール選びでは、カリキュラムや講師の質、サポート体制をしっかり確認しましょう。オンラインと対面のどちらが自分に合っているのかも考えながら、学習を進めていくことが重要です。あなたの学びが実を結び、素晴らしいアプリ開発者としての道を切り開いていくことを応援しています。